What is ACH?
The Automated Clearing House (ACH) is a financial network that enables electronic payments and money transfers between banks in the United States. Established in the 1970s, it has evolved significantly over the years to accommodate various types of transactions such as direct deposits, bill payments, and even e-commerce transactions.

Challenges and Considerations
While ACH international transfers present immense opportunities, there are challenges that software developers need to navigate:
1. Regulatory Compliance
Each country has its own regulations concerning international money transfers. Developers need to stay informed about these laws to avoid legal pitfalls.
2. Currency Exchange Rates
Handling multiple currencies can complicate transactions due to fluctuating exchange rates. Developers should consider integrating a reliable currency conversion API.
3. Customer Support
Issues during an international transfer can be more complicated than domestic ones. Therefore, having a robust customer support system in place is necessary to assist users effectively.
